Las Rosas is a city and municipality located in the southern Mexican state of Chiapas. It is an important part of Mexico's geography.
As of 2010, the municipality of Las Rosas had a total population of 25,530 people. This number was higher than the 21,100 people recorded in 2005. The entire area of the municipality covers about 233.5 square kilometers (about 90 square miles).
The city of Las Rosas itself had a population of 18,817 in 2010. Besides the main city, the municipality includes 130 smaller communities. None of these smaller places had more than 1,000 residents.
